SUMMARY:Film Independent’s Episodic Lab
DESCRIPTION:Opportunity type: Fellowship\nFor: Writers\nDeadline: 02/02/2026 \nRewards: $20,000 + mentorship + pitch opportunity + more\nLocation Eligibility: Worldwide\n\nAbout this opportunity\n\n Film Independent’s Episodic Lab supports emerging writers developing original long-form episodic projects. The program selects 6–8 writers or writing teams with completed half-hour or hour-long pilots and provides them with intensive creative and professional support to revise, refine, and pitch their work.\nFellows receive personalized mentorship from experienced showrunners, creative producers, and industry executives. Each participant is paired with a Creative Advisor for one-on-one and group sessions throughout August, focused on strengthening both craft and career strategy. The Lab culminates in a networking and pitch event with studio and network executives, offering Fellows direct industry exposure.\nOne participant will also be selected to receive the Alfred P. Sloan Episodic Lab Grant, awarded to projects that meaningfully engage with science, technology, or mathematics.\nRewards\n\n$20,000 Alfred P. Sloan Episodic Lab Development Grant\nOne-on-one mentorship with an assigned Creative Advisor\nGroup sessions with industry professionals and showrunners\nFinal networking and pitch event with studio and network executives\n\nEligibility\n\n\n\nOpen to emerging writers worldwide\nApplicants must submit a completed draft of a half-hour or hour-long episodic pilot\nApplicants must be the author and rights holder of the submitted script\nWriting teams may apply with a single joint application\nThe submitted pilot must not have been pitched to a studio or network\nFictional episodic projects only\nDocumentary series and short-form digital series are not eligible\n\nFor the Alfred P. Sloan Episodic Lab Grant:\n\nProject must meaningfully engage with science, mathematics, or technology\nMay include a scientist, engineer, or mathematician as a lead character\nScience fiction projects are not eligible for the Sloan grant\n\nEntry Fee\n\n\n\nFREE for Filmmaker Pro Members (limited to one waived fee per Membership year)\n$45 for Film Independent Members\n$65 for non-Members\n\nHow to Apply \nApply using the link:  Film Independent’s Episodic Lab\nAll questions regarding this award should be sent to artistdevelopment@filmindependent.org ( mailto:artistdevelopment@filmindependent.org )\n
